Airports in Amman
Queen Alia International Airport (AMM)
Queen Alia International Airport (AMM) is around 40 kilometres from the centre of Amman. If you're getting a cab or a ride-share, the drive takes roughly 45 minutes.

The warmest month in Amman is July, with temperatures ranging between 20ºC (68ºF) and 36ºC (97ºF). Lock in your Dubrovnik Airport to Amman plane ticket then if that's your definition of good weather.
January sees average temperatures of between 4ºC (39ºF) and 17ºC (63ºF). Look for a cheap ticket from DBV to Amman around that time if you like travelling in cooler conditions.

There are so many things to see and do in this city it can be tricky to work out where to begin. Viewpoint roman theatre, Amman Citadel and Rainbow Street are popular attractions which should feature on every Amman itinerary.

You've seen Amman, now it's time to discover other parts of Jordan. Journey about 290 kilometres south to Aqaba to tick off its top sights. From Aqaba Fort to Mamluk Castle and Aqaba Museum, there's plenty to keep you on the go.
If you're eager to discover another great destination in Jordan, head for Petra, about 193 kilometres south of Amman. Al-Khubtha Trail, Haut-lieu du Sacrifice and Watching the sunset are key reasons to visit.
